Post CXBX progress

Over in this thread, there are several screenshots from shadow_tj which show an impressive progress going on with the X-Box emulator CXBX. The screenshots show the self running in-game demo from Rayman. Though we're not 100% sure yet if this is a movie or actually the game engine displaying the graphics, the shots are very nice to look at - see for yourself:

   

Great work caustik and KingofC! For more CXBX screenshots, make sure to check out our CXBX section!

These are from a TV capture card, you can see interlace artifacts, the tv overscan and overall the picture is blurry.

Unless what you mean is that the emulator is playing back an X-box movie file.. But then where is the window title and border?

I don't think an xmv would be that interlaced.
Here's what I think it is: if you look carefully at the larger rayman picture(s) you can see small horizontal lines in some places; they dont show up everywhere; a program called 'dscaler' was used, which largely 'deinterlaces' (removes those scanlines from) the tv input

for comparison; take a look at the shots in this thread:
http://www.ngemu.com/forums/showthread.php?t=9003
I made those from a DC using dscaler and a tv capture card; if you look carefully you'll notice the same horizontal lines.
